Nicona Lane is a senior marketing & communications strategist for Our Blood Institute. With the birth of her second child, Brock, in November of 2022, Nicona experienced a placenta abruption. After Brock was delivered through an emergency C-section, Nicona felt weak and even nearly passed out. She was given a blood transfusion to help regain her strength so she could safely take her newborn baby home.

"Because I work for OBI, Our Blood Institute, I know how important blood donations are and how lifesaving it is to patients. I never thought that I would be the one needing the blood," Nicona said.
